A can of tennis balls costs $6. The total cost c of n cans, including sales tax t, is given by the equation c = 6n + t. Which is

the best reason why c – t = 6n?
Mathematics
1 answer:
lora16 [44]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

The reason why c = 6n + t is the same as c - t = 6n is because c is the sum of the addition problem. 6n and t are the addends. The inverse operation for addition is subtraction. c is the cost that will be reduced by t. The answer is still 6n.
